Design Architect

Architectural | Sydney | Full Time

Job Description

Grimshaw is a global architecture and design studio of ideas and invention, driven by a desire to connect people to each other and the world around us. We recognise the urgency of the challenges that face our planet, and our duty to deliver architecture and design best suited for a flourishing future. Our studios are founded on analysis and exploration. We relish the challenges inherent across a wide range of work, engaging our expertise and agility to deliver lasting, meaningful design that brings value and joy to clients and users. At Grimshaw, we encourage creativity, collaboration and innovation. We want our staff to be fulfilled by their time with us as we know the key to our continuing success is working with and engaging the most talented people we can find.

We are currently seeking talented Design Architects to join our Sydney Studio, predominately working on either Education, Transport, Master Planning or Mixed-Use related projects.

Key responsibilities include:

  • Contribute to the successful delivery of a complex, large scale project

  • Have responsibility for specific roles, areas or packages within a project

  • Work within an agreed scope and deliver complete ‘packages’ of work to deadline

  • Demonstrate design and technical aptitude, with developing design and technical confidence

  • Contribute to the generation and exploration of design and construction ideas, being aware of the balance of conceptual, aesthetic, constructional and cost influences

  • Contribute to the design work on ‘big picture’ context, objectives, composition, materials and colour, architectural ‘volume’ control, detail quality and build quality

  • Develop design work in close cooperation with other members of the Grimshaw project team

  • Assist with liaison with the client, stakeholders and authorities, in collaboration with Project Leads

  • Be attentive of client feedback, issues or potential problems and report any issues raised

  • Help assist and coach junior team members on the project

To be successful you will have:

  • 3 - 7 years’ experience

  • Master’s Degree in Architecture or equivalent

  • Exceptional design skills with experience working on large scale projects

  • Knowledge of construction industry legislation, practice and procedures

  • Working knowledge of all project work stages

  • Experience with Revit is essential

  • Excellent communication skills to work with internal and external clients

  • Ability to work effectively as part of a team

  • Ability to analyse and critically assess problems

  • Imaginative and creative thinking skills and ability

  • Registered or working towards architectural registration
